/* https://www.mapstime.fr/wp-content/themes/mapstime/assets/css/responsive-l.css?ver=79addd */
@media all and (max-width:1024px){body{font-size:18px}h1{font-size:2rem}h2{font-size:1.75rem}h3{font-size:1.5rem}h4{font-size:1.25rem}h5{font-size:1rem}.header__logo{width:30%}.header__info{width:40%}.header__info img{height:76px}.header__app{width:25%}.footer__site__map,.footer__site__social{width:50%}.footer__site__presentation{clear:both;display:block;width:100%}.footer__site__presentation__contact{width:19em}}@media all and (min-width:701px){.header__nav{height:4em;transition:height .5s}.header .menu{display:block;padding:0;margin:0;list-style:none;width:100%;top:0;left:0}.header .menu>li{display:inline-block;position:relative;width:25%;height:4em;transition:height .5s;text-align:center;margin-right:-5px}.header .sub-menu{display:block;position:absolute;left:0;background:#494948;padding:0;opacity:0;height:0;width:100%;transition:opacity 1s}.header .sub-menu li a{padding:1em 3ex}.header .menu>li:hover .sub-menu,.header .menu a:focus+.sub-menu{opacity:1;height:auto}.header .menu-item-has-children{line-height:4em;transition:line-height .5s}.header .menu-item-has-children>a::after{font-family:Fontawesome;content:"\f0d7";color:#fff;padding-left:.5ex}}